Just outside London, this commuter town boasts The Lightbox gallery with rotating art exhibitions and local history displays. Explore the peaceful Shah Jahan Mosque, Britain's first purpose-built mosque, or catch performances at the New Victoria Theatre in Woking's town centre.

Best time to go to Woking

The best time to visit Woking is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ather in Woking?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 17°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Woking is 732 mm.
